    EWI-746F Fine Finish Lime Render NHL 2 is part of the EWI Pro Heritage Range, designed for projects where breathability, moisture movement and compatibility with traditional building materials are essential. Formulated using NHL 2 as the primary binder, it provides a finer finishing coat for breathable lime render and plaster systems, making it especially well suited to heritage, conservation and refurbishment work where a more compatible alternative to dense cement-based materials is preferred. Made with natural hydraulic lime, selected sands and additives, it offers good workability, vapour permeability and a more refined traditional finish.

    Designed for use as a fine finishing coat over breathable lime render systems, EWI-746F helps maintain the natural movement of moisture through the wall structure while giving a smoother, more decorative final surface. It is suitable for both internal and external applications where the binder strength is appropriate for the substrate, and can be finished by floating or sponging depending on the texture required.

    Substrate Preparation

    Substrates must be sound, clean and free from contaminants that could impair adhesion, including dust, debris and loose material. Preparation should suit the condition and suction of the background. Dense or low-suction surfaces may need only minimal dampening, while more porous backgrounds should be dampened before application to help prevent rapid drying. The substrate should be damp but not saturated, with no standing water present. Prepare and protect the work area before application begins.

    Product Preparation

    Mix EWI-746F Fine Finish Lime Render NHL 2 exclusively with clean water at a rate of 4 to 4.7 litres per 25kg bag.

    • Add water to a clean container first
    • Gradually introduce the powder while mixing
    • Mix for 5 to 10 minutes
    • Allow the material to stand for 10 to 20 minutes
    • Remix thoroughly before use

    Do not add admixtures or other materials. Do not increase the water content by more than 10%, as excess water may cause shrinkage and cracking. Where part bags are used, the contents should be dry blended first, as settlement can occur during storage or transport. Use full bags wherever possible to maintain consistency.

    Application

    EWI-746F Fine Finish Lime Render NHL 2 is applied as a finishing coat over lime render or basecoat. Apply at 5 to 7mm and finish by floating, with optional sponging depending on the required texture.

    • Apply as a fine finishing coat over a suitable lime basecoat
    • Apply at 5 to 7mm
    • Finish by floating for a traditional finish
    • Sponging can be used where a different surface texture is required
    • For false ashlar or similar lined finishes, maintain enough thickness to avoid drawing out the coarser aggregate beneath
    • In these applications, do not apply thicker than 8mm

    For colour consistency across unpainted elevations, use material from the same batch across each elevation.

    Technical Data

    Property Value
    Product Type Fine Finish Natural Hydraulic Lime Render
    Lime Classification NHL 2
    Composition Natural Hydraulic Lime, Natural Sands, Additives
    Yield Approx. 15 litres per 25kg
    Coverage Approx. 1.9m² at 7mm thickness per 25kg
    Aggregate 3mm down blended sand
    Water Mix Ratio 4–4.7 litres per 25kg
    Application Method Manual
    Layer Thickness 5–7mm
    Reaction to Fire Class A1
    Packaging 25kg polythene-lined paper bag
    Shelf Life Best used within 6 months from manufacture

    Storage Conditions

    Store in original, unopened packaging under cover, off the ground and keep dry at all times. Opened or part-used bags should be resealed and protected from moisture. For best performance, use within 6 months of manufacture.
